“鍵”和”正規化”,瞭解一下~
超鍵:
能確定一條資訊的屬性或屬性集合
候選鍵:
最小超鍵,能確定一條資訊的最小屬性集合(可能有幾組,也可能只一組)
主鍵:
從候選鍵中任意定義其中的一組屬性集合,即為主鍵
外來鍵:
兩個關係中,一個關係的主鍵即為另一關係的外來鍵,||該外來鍵需在此關係中做普通屬性||
第一正規化:
屬性值不可再分(即沒有被合併的單元格)
第二正規化:
消除區域性依賴(非主屬性必須完全依賴於主屬性(候選關鍵字))
①、當主鍵為一個屬性時,一定是第二正規化。
理由:只一個屬性就能確定其他屬性,無法存在部分依賴,故為第二正規化
②、當主鍵為多個屬性時,考慮是否存在主鍵中的單個屬性就可以確定關係中的非主屬性,如果可以,即存在部分依賴,並非第二正規化。
第三正規化:
消除傳遞依賴(非主屬性之間不能存在依賴關係),由此,就避免了出現非主屬性傳遞依賴於主鍵(候選關鍵字)
相關推薦
“鍵”和”正規化”,瞭解一下~
超鍵: 能確定一條資訊的屬性或屬性集合 候選鍵: 最小超鍵,能確定一條資訊的最小屬性集合(可能有幾組,也可能只一組) 主鍵: 從候選鍵中任意定義其中的一組屬性集合,即為主鍵 外來鍵: 兩個關係中,一個關係的主鍵即為另一關係的外來鍵,||該外來鍵需在此關係中做普通屬性||
css背景和邊框,瞭解一下
css圓角邊框 border-radius 表格border-collapse屬性為separate,表格圓角才能正常顯示 背景屬性 background-color background-image background-repeat
Dubbo加權輪詢負載均衡的原始碼和Bug,瞭解一下?
本文是對於Dubbo負載均衡策略之一的加權隨機演算法的詳細分析。從2.6.4版本聊起,該版本在某些情況下存在著比較嚴重的效能問題。由問題入手,層層深入,瞭解該演算法在Dubbo中的演變過程,讀懂它的前世今生。 之前也寫了Dubbo的負載均衡策略: 《
電腦下一些常用快捷鍵,瞭解一下
-Ctrl快捷鍵Ctrl+S 儲存Ctrl+W 關閉程式Ctrl+N 新建Ctrl+O 開啟Ctrl+Z 撤銷Ctrl+F 查詢Ctrl+X 剪下Ctrl+C 複製Ctrl+V 貼上Ctrl+A 全選Ctrl+[ 縮小文字Ctrl+] 放大文字Ctrl+B 粗體Ctrl+I
Excel資料錄入技巧,瞭解一下
1.資料有效性 快速錄入多個不同條件,用下拉列表來完成是比較快的~ 步驟:選中目標區域—資料—資料驗證—序列—來源—輸入目標條件(來源中隔開文字的逗號是英文逗號) 2.提取年齡 在一大波出生年月中,想要提取年齡的話,一個個弄是不現實的,用公式最快~ 公式應用:=DATEDIF(B2,TO
爬蟲敏感圖片的識別與過濾,瞭解一下?
需求 我們需要識別出敏感作者的avatar頭像,把”皮卡丘“換成”優雅的python“。 敏感圖片樣本屬性: 爬蟲獲取的圖片屬性: 替換成: 原理 檢查兩個圖片的相似度,一個簡單而快速的演算法:感知雜湊演算法(Perceptual Hash),通過某種提取
MindManager 2019新版上市 ,瞭解一下!
所有的等待都是值得的!MindManager在蓄力一年後,給各位思維導圖愛好者帶來了全新的MindManager 2019 for Windows。全新的版本包含英語、德語、法語、俄語、中文、日語,新增的優先檢視,時間表檢視,業務戰略工具包等為使用者帶來了全新的操作體驗。在使用MindManage
中國版的 Fama-French 三因子模型,瞭解一下?
作者:石川,量信投資創始合夥人,清華大學學士、碩士,麻省理工學院博士;精通各種概率模型和統計方法,擅長不確定性隨機系統的建模及優化。(已獲授權轉載) 摘要:Liu et al. (2018) 通過剔除市值最小的 30% 的股票降低了殼價值汙染,在 Fama-French 三因子的基礎上提出了適合
不用L約束又不會梯度消失的GAN,瞭解一下?
先擺結論: 1. 論文提供了一種分析和構造概率散度的直接思路,從而簡化了構建新 GAN 框架的過程; 2. 推匯出了一個稱為 GAN-QP 的 GAN 框架,這個 GAN 不需要像 WGAN 那樣的 L 約束,又不會有 SGAN 的梯度消失問題,實驗表明它至少有不遜色於、甚至優於 WGAN 的表現。
機器學習,瞭解一下?
1. 為什麼要學? 老師上課時候就說過:傳統演算法解決確定性問題,而機器學習解決非確定性問題。 好吧,確實激起了我的興趣,所以系統學習一下吧。 文章圖片來源於 GitHub,網速不佳的朋友請點我看原文。 順便軟廣一下個人技術小站:godbmw.com。歡迎常來♪(^∇^*) 2. 機器學習演算法 機器學習
iOS Push詳述,瞭解一下?
歡迎大家前往騰訊雲+社群,獲取更多騰訊海量技術實踐乾貨哦~ 作者:陳裕發, 騰訊系統測試工程師 商業轉載請聯絡騰訊WeTest獲得授權,非商業轉載請註明出處。 WeTest 導讀 本文主要對iOS Push的線上push、本地push及離線(遠端)push進行梳理,介紹了相關邏輯,測試時要注意的要點以及
express中介軟體,瞭解一下
本篇文章從express原始碼上來理解中介軟體,同時可以對express有更深層的理解 前言 中介軟體函式可以執行哪些任務? 執行任何程式碼。 對請求和響應物件進行更改。 結束請求/響應迴圈。 呼叫堆疊中的下一個中介軟體函式。 我們從一個app.use開始,逐
Bash這個Shell,瞭解一下概念
BoumeAgain Shell(bash),是一個Bourne Shell的增強版本,基準於GNU架構下發展出來。 GNU是一個自由的作業系統,其內容軟體完全以GPL方式釋出。這個作業系統是GNU計劃的主要目標,名稱來自GNU’s Not Unix!的遞迴縮
史上最強資源網站,瞭解一下?
2018/4/23推薦列表虫部落快搜美劇線上看線上格式工廠論文導航PPT模板搜圖1.虫部落快搜連結http://search.chongbuluo.com/簡介這個網站真的無所不能,大家看圖片就知道了,你想查的所有的東西基本上都能在這上面找到,查字型,查文獻,查ACG資源,電子書資源,GitHub程式,論文資
async/await,瞭解一下?
一開始寫文章的時候太晚了,程式碼有一處複製錯誤,已改正,謝謝博友提醒,保證以後不會再犯。 上一篇部落格我們在現實使用和麵試角度講解了Promise(原文可參考《面向面試題和實際使用談promise》),但是Promise 的方式雖然解決了 callback hell,但是這種方式充滿了 Promise
區塊鏈遊戲,瞭解一下!
在這之前,我們先了解一下區塊鏈:區塊鏈是處於非安全環境下的分散式資料庫,是使用加密演算法將資料按先後順序相連的一條鏈,後一資料記錄前一資料的位置和內容,以保證資料難以被篡改和攻擊。其通過共識演算法來使各個節點對新增的資料達成共識,來新增區塊。為便於檢索檢視,我們根據現階段情況
__blank,瞭解一下?
html5新特性吧,前些天瀏覽網站發現的,開始我還以為是JS控制新開啟的視窗呢~ <a href="https://me.csdn.net/qq_39571197" target="__blank">111111</a> <a href="htt
最通俗易懂的DAPP解釋,瞭解一下?
傳統的APP相信大家已經耳熟能詳了,那麼傳統的APP具有哪些缺點呢?大致來說,APP目前存在以下幾個問題 1、強行捆綁推廣其他應用軟體; 2、未經使用者同意,收集、使用使用者個人資訊; 3、使用者不知情的情況下,自動向外發送資訊 4、造成手機頻繁卡頓 5、惡意收費
從AndroidStudio的啟動引數開始,瞭解一下JVM的一些東西(記憶體使用,JIT等)
如果你使用AndroidStudio經常覺得很卡,那有可能是因為系統給AS分配的記憶體不夠的原因。開啟/Applications/Android Studio.app/Contents/bin/studio.vmoptions (Mac),可以看到有以下配置: -Xms128m -Xmx750m
騰訊技術崗內推,瞭解一下!
屬於你們的福利來了!!! 貨真價實的騰訊技術崗內推!!! 您需要關注我的微信公眾號—— Android機動車 ,回覆 騰訊內推 ,獲取聯絡方式。要注意的是,您如果認為您真的符合招聘需求並近期打算跳槽再進行聯絡和投遞,非誠勿擾。 您還可以持續關注Androi